How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 78612?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 78612 Studio Apartments | $1,362 | $1,299 | $1,464 |
| 78612 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,540 | $1,193 | $2,707 |
| 78612 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,838 | $1,403 | $3,179 |
| 78612 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,217 | $1,620 | $4,231 |
| 78612 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,005 | $2,497 | $4,947 |
